Abstract
Two field experiments were carried out to study the efficiency of cobalt and different organic fertilizers. Experiments were conducted at Agricultural Experimental Station of the National Research Centre at Nubaria, Beheira Governorate Egypt, in two successive seasons 2017/2018 and 2018/2019 under drip irrigation system. The obtained results are summarized in the following: The greatest chickpea growth and yield parameters were attained in plants with treated with chicken manure followed by farmyard manure while agriculture compost was the lowest ones. Application cobalt at 12 ppm to all studied organic fertilizers enhancing chickpea nodulation rate, growth and seeds yield quantity and its quality. The superior chickpea growth and yield parameter were attained in plants which supplied with cobalt at 12 ppm with chicken manure followed by farmyard manure while cotton compost resulted the lowest ones.
